Before the advent of the Europeans encounter, extensive contacts existed between empires and kingdoms on the continent. These sometimes had similar organizational systems and cultures. Benin developed into a major kingdom during the same period that Oyo (Yoruba empire was becoming dominant to the West. To the west of Borno, the Hausa-Fulani built their cities around Kano, Katsina, and Gobor This simultaneous emergence and various contacts, resulted in a cross-fertilization and dialogue among these powerful states of the Bight of Benin.
